2000 Ford Ka review from UK and Ireland
"Appearance is not everything"
What things have gone wrong with the car?
By 7,000 miles (over 1 year) the rear windscreen wiper would work when it wanted to, I took the car to the garage from where it was purchased and I was informed by the salesman that due to the low mileage, I had obviously not used the car enough and hence this was why the wiper would only occasionally work. I then returned to speak with the mechanic who told me it was a common problem and just a loose connection.
Over the last two years the car has started to over-rev whenever you slow down, so it sounds dreadful driving round a car park at 10 mph with the engine roaring.
The steering often becomes heavy and feels like a tank around bends especially.
Both these incidents have been reported to different garages who can't find any fault with the car, but it has been mentioned that there could be a fault with the steering rack.
The spark plugs have welded with rust to the engine twice. the car has only done nearly 35,000 miles and is on its third set of sparks! the last time it had to be drilled out because it had been broken off (by the mechanic)
The car failed its first mot with a broken wishbone, which for 18,000 the garage were very confused to how it could have broke.
The car has rusted on the back side windows, and by the passenger door and obviously the engine surrounding the spark plugs.
The brakes are not particularly brilliant even after the disc's and pads were changed. the garaged aired the brakes and tried changing the cylinder because they couldnt understand why the brakes were not working to their full capacity.
The boot has to be slammed very hard as sometimes it won't close, i have been advised to rub the mental components with sand paper.
General comments?
The car is fabulous for a girly girl car, I was really excited when I got this car, but now 4 years on I have had enough with it, I know the wheel bearing is starting to go and no doubt the exhaust will be going soon as it has yet to be changed.
This car has a great exterior and looks fun and funky, but once you scratch beneath the surface its hard to find a happy ford ka driver and it didn't suprise me to hear that it had been voted in the top 10 worst cars.
I definitely won't purchase a ford again, but apparently their engines have never been modified and are based on the old fiesta engine.
